Getting to Know Your Generator: Types and Functions
Generators serve as essential sources of power in a wide range of situations, from residential use to industrial applications. They fall broadly into two categories: portable and standby types. Portable generators are typically smaller and designed for temporary use, making them a great choice for camping, tailgating, or serving as emergency backup during outages. These generators offer convenience and flexibility, giving users the ability to move them effortlessly as the situation demands.
Standby generators, on the other hand, are permanently installed and automatically activate during power failures. They are typically integrated into the home's electrical system, offering a smooth transition to backup power. Among these categories, generators have the ability to function on a range of fuel sources, including gasoline, diesel, propane, or natural gas, each presenting its own unique pros and cons.
Understanding the different forms and applications of generators is crucial for identifying the right tools for individual demands, securing stability and productivity in electricity provision.
Identifying Common Generator Issues
Detecting generator faults in a timely manner can prevent further complications and secure reliable performance. Typical generator issues frequently present as strange sounds, difficulty starting, or uneven power delivery. When a generator has difficulty starting, it could point to a drained battery, fuel-related problems, or a defective ignition system. Strange noises, including grinding or rattling, may indicate mechanical deterioration or unsecured parts, requiring prompt examination.
Electrical surges commonly suggest concerns involving the electrical regulator or additional electrical parts, impacting general performance. Additionally, generators might release emissions or strong scents, hinting at fuel leaks or overheating, which demand immediate action. Routinely inspecting air filters, fuel reserves, and oil integrity can assist in recognizing these concerns at an early stage. By understanding these typical warning signs, generator users can take proactive steps to guarantee their machinery stays operational and effective, ultimately prolonging its durability and dependability.

Regular Oil Changes
One of the most critical elements of generator maintenance is the practice of regular oil changes. relevant information This procedure guarantees that the engine operates smoothly and effectively by limiting friction and protecting against wear. Over time, oil may accumulate contaminants, metal fragments, and combustion deposits, causing diminished performance and potential harm. It is widely advised to change the oil after every 100 hours of operation or at least once a year, whichever comes first. Applying the right type and grade of oil, as outlined by the manufacturer, is essential for optimal performance. Ignoring this upkeep responsibility can cause overheating, elevated fuel usage, and ultimately, generator breakdown. Regular oil changes are crucial for extending the lifespan of the generator.
Clean Air Filters
Keeping air filters clean is vital for optimal generator performance and long-term durability. Air filters act as a barrier against dust and debris reaching the engine, which can lead to poor combustion and serious damage. Routine inspection and cleaning of air filters are essential, especially in environments with high dust levels. It is recommended to check filters every few months and change them out if they exhibit signs of deterioration or significant debris buildup. Keeping an air filter clean optimizes airflow, enhancing fuel efficiency and reducing strain on the engine. This straightforward upkeep task can significantly prolong the generator's lifespan, making certain it functions efficiently when called upon. By prioritizing air filter cleanliness, individuals can preserve their investment in generator efficiency and dependability.
Step-by-Step Troubleshooting Techniques
Troubleshooting a generator calls for a structured approach to pinpoint and address issues effectively. The first step involves checking the primary power components. If the generator does not start, verify the fuel tank is adequately filled and the fuel is clean and fresh. Following that, inspect the oil level; insufficient oil may cause automatic shutdowns. Following this, examine the battery connections for rust or loose fittings. If the generator operates but generates no electricity, checking the circuit breaker and fuses is essential.
Additionally, assess the spark plug for signs of wear or damage, as a defective spark plug can impede starting. If the unit makes unusual noises, this may signal internal issues requiring further investigation. Lastly, reviewing the owner's manual for detailed troubleshooting instructions can deliver targeted remedies. By implementing these steps, one can systematically identify and address common generator problems, guaranteeing consistent functionality when necessary.
Observe Safety Guidelines for Generator Repairs
When fixing a generator, following safety precautions is essential to avoid accidents and injuries. As a first step, ensure that the generator is powered down and disconnected from any power source. This helps prevent the risk of electric shock. Wearing personal protective equipment, including gloves and safety glasses, can further safeguard against potential hazards. Working in a well-ventilated area is strongly encouraged to minimize exposure to harmful fumes from fuel or exhaust.
Furthermore, storing a fire extinguisher close by is crucial, as generators can represent fire risks. Technicians should also be careful when dealing with fuel, making sure that leaks and spills are cleaned up without delay to reduce the chances of accidents and fires. To conclude, having a first aid kit readily available can be beneficial in case of minor injuries. By adhering to these safety guidelines, individuals can establish a safer workspace while conducting generator maintenance, ensuring the safety of both the technician and the equipment.
When Should You Hire a Pro for Generator Repairs?
Generator fixes can often be tackled by experienced individuals, but some circumstances require the skills of a trained professional. If a generator fails to start after basic troubleshooting, this could point to underlying problems that demand expert understanding. Additionally, ongoing strange sounds or vibrations may indicate mechanical issues that could deteriorate without professional attention.
Electrical issues, such as faulty circuit breakers or melted wires, create substantial safety concerns and require attention from a licensed electrician. If the generator is leaking fuel or oil, prompt expert help is necessary to eliminate the threat of fire dangers. Additionally, if the generator is still under warranty, performing self-repairs could invalidate the warranty, making expert assistance the smarter decision. Understanding these circumstances confirms the generator functions reliably and securely, extending its lifespan and dependability.
Getting Your Generator Set for Seasonal Transitions
As seasons change, preparing a generator for different weather conditions is vital to maintain top performance. Routine maintenance ought to be planned ahead of seasonal transitions, focusing on tasks that suit the upcoming climate. For winter preparation, confirming proper fuel stabilization and battery health is critical, because frigid temperatures can influence performance. Moreover, examining the oil levels and swapping filters assists in reducing complications during demanding usage.
In contrast, seasonal summer maintenance entails inspecting cooling systems, as rising temperatures can result in overheating. Servicing air filters and reviewing ventilation pathways are key for adequate airflow.
On a regular basis throughout the year, it is essential to conduct regular load tests on the generator to verify functionality. This approach not only detects possible issues but also assures reliability when needed. Furthermore, shielding the generator from severe environmental factors, like heavy rain or snowfall, by utilizing proper covers or protective housing can greatly extend its lifespan and preserve optimal performance.

How Frequently Should I Operate My Generator for Maintenance?
Generators need to be started at least once a month as part of routine maintenance. Consistent operation assists in keeping fuel in good condition, keeps internal components lubricated, and detects possible problems, providing consistent performance when necessary, ultimately lengthening the lifespan of the generator.
Am I Able to Use My Generator Inside?
Indoor use of generators should always be avoided as a result of the serious carbon monoxide poisoning hazard. Sufficient ventilation is critically important, so they should always be run outdoors in areas with proper airflow to ensure safety and avoid the buildup of dangerous gases.

What Is the Safest Way to Store My Generator?
For safe generator storage, make sure it's free of dirt and moisture, drain the fuel to avoid degradation, protect it with a covering tarp, and keep it in a well-ventilated, dry area away from flammable materials.
